I'll have a go:
Upgrade your ROM. Yours is about 1.06, current is 1.12 (or 1.13? Not much differnce).
Ensure there is a language version the same as yours, and then upgrade. That's a complicated enough procedure, but follow the instructions carefully provided with the ROMs and you'll be ok.
The upgrade for more memory, is the BigStorage ROM hack. This will replace the area on your phone known as "Extended Memory", and convert it into more useful "Storage" that you can use. Basically, your phone gains 20mb of usable space. I've written an ENORMOUS post about this here (near the bottom of the screen)
To do BigStorage, you should use a tool floating around on the board that will patch ANY rom to BigStorage. That way, you can hack your own ROM for this. This is important because the first 400bytes or so of your ROM are unique to you, and you want to keep that. So I recommend:
1. Backup your PPC with Sprite backup or similar.
2. Upgrade your ROM to 1.12 (public sources or from the XDA Developers FTP site).
3. Make a backup of your ROM (optional, but advised).
4. Apply the BigStorage ROM hack.
You may be able to skip 4 if you can find the ROM you want at (2) already hacked. This is likely. But whatever you do, follow the instructions provided carefully. There are a couple of errors that are SUPPOSED to come up in the procedure. Read the instructions and you'll know what's supposed to happen.
Phew. It takes some learning, but you'll get there.

Now we can make the Emonster english. I've tried this using both the L26_daimond and Hyperdragon III. The only thing I haven't been able to make work is display of Japanese Fonts. So if someones solves that life will be great. What you need to do:
First get hard SPL installed then
grap the 1.71 radio from this thread http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=410953 Thanks to AllTheWay for ripping the radio from the newest Emonster ROM
Get one of the new cooked ROMS I have tried L26_Diamond and HyberDragon III the Augest 4 version
after installing the ROM Install the radio rom from the above thread and you now have a working EMonster with everything in English.
Still need to solve the Japanese font problem or you won't be able to read emails from your Japanese or browse Japanese sites.

You need to fix the registry after install let's Japan No.6.
[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\System\CurrentControlSet\Control\Layouts\e0010411]
“Keyboard Layout”=”00000409″
Or you can get the cab file to fix it from here;
http://sony-ericsson.air-nifty.com/g900/2007/08/lets_japan_no6.html
(If you click "こちら" in the text, you can get the cab file to fix this problem.)

This thread will help you.
http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=433835
1. Install Hard-SPL
2. Choose english rom which you want and install it.
You can choose any cooked rom in this forum. But WM6.1 should be much easier to install Japanese font.
3. Install Askal's "let's Japan No.6"
You can search it with Google.
4. Get the cab file to fix keyboard problem
http://sony-ericsson.air-nifty.com/g...japan_no6.html
That's it.
